Required courses: ECE 6005 Computer Architecture and Design; At least five of the following courses: WebJun 25, 2024 · Another cause of computer eye strain is focusing fatigue. To reduce your risk of tiring your eyes by constantly focusing on your screen, look away from your computer at least every 20 minutes and gaze at a distant object (at least 20 feet away) for at least 20 seconds. Some opticians call this the "20-20-20 rule." flights from cape town to george south africa https://msink.net

WebFor example, when you can not focus properly on the distance of your computer monitor within your arms reach you need to increase the reading power a little to be able to see clearly again. When the computer monitor sits 31.5 inches/ 80 cm in front of you an added reading power of 1.25 Diopters is needed maximally so you can see clearly on your ...
